Job Description

We’re looking for a Finance Implementation Manager to join our fast growing Finance Product team in London. This role is a unique opportunity to have an impact on Wise’s mission by ensuring we build smart and scalable internal financial systems and empower millions more people with instant, borderless money.

Your Mission

As a financial institution moving billions of GBP of customer money in more than 70 countries, Wise must have bulletproof financials. 

Wise is rapidly expanding globally, creating new products to consumers and businesses, and entering new jurisdictions. This is a unique opportunity to lead complex projects implementing new Wise products and markets into Wise’s finance system supporting Wise in being financially compliant and ensures our bigger team can make timely, accurate and sustainable business decisions based on a global set of financials.

How you’ll contribute to our mission

Planning and scoping

You will be a key point of contact for Product teams and Finance stakeholders on integrating new products, features and regional expansions to ensure Wise has accurate view of currency exposures

You will review the existing implementations for any risks and gaps

You will proactively engage with relevant product teams to understand their needs, and navigate prioritisation problems ensure impact to Finance are minimised

You will develop an Implementation roadmap and lead quarterly planning of Finance Implementation work, as part of the wider team quarterly planning

Execution and implementation

You will figure out a plan and work with a team of product managers, engineers, data analysts and operations specialists to integrate all new Wise products, regions and entities into our finance system

You will be owning large and complex integrations and you will support the team with clear documentation including requirements, detailed project plans, resource allocation, testing, delivery etc.

You will support operations teams through new implementations, including training regional operations teams on safeguarding processes as part of regional expansions

Support

You will ensure documentation of product flows

You will get hands-on when things go wrong - supporting product and engineering teams during incidents to understand the impact, drive resolution and improve controls to prevent similar incidents recurring

Why the UK Could Be the World’s Next Machine Learning Jobs Hub

Machine learning (ML) is becoming essential to industries across the globe—from finance and healthcare to retail, logistics, defence, and the public sector. Its ability to uncover patterns in data, make predictions, drive automation, and increase operational efficiency has made it one of the most in-demand skill sets in the technology world. In the UK, machine learning roles—from engineers to researchers, product managers to analysts—are increasingly central to innovation. Universities are expanding ML programmes, enterprises are scaling ML deployments, and startups are offering applied ML solutions. All signs point toward a surging need for professionals skilled in modelling, algorithms, data pipelines, and AI systems. This article explores why the United Kingdom is exceptionally well positioned to become a global machine learning jobs hub. It examines the current landscape, strengths, career paths, sector-specific demand, challenges, and what must happen for this vision to become reality.
